Q1: What is the ESP32 IoT Smart Home Automation Kit?
A1: It is a cloud-connected starter kit built around the ESP32 Wi-Fi + Bluetooth microcontroller. Students build a smart home model that lets them monitor indoor temperature/humidity and switch light/fan relays remotely via a mobile app (Blynk / Adafruit IO).

Q2: Does this IoT kit require an internet or Wi-Fi connection?
A2: Yes, the ESP32 connects to any standard home 2.4GHz Wi-Fi router or mobile phone hotspot to exchange data with cloud IoT servers.

Q3: Is soldering required to connect the sensors and relays?
A3: No soldering is required. Components plug into standard breadboards and pin headers using insulated jumper wires.

Q7: What components are included in the IoT kit box?
A7: Includes ESP32 Wi-Fi dev board, 4-channel relay module, DHT11 temp sensor, LDR light sensor, OLED screen, breadboard, USB cable, jumper wires, and cloud setup guide.
